2011-01-03 9 views
1

英語の母国語ではない。私はあなたが私の意味を理解してくれることを願っています A iはカウンターとカテゴリ 入手方法.Netメソッド情報PerformanceCounterCategoryカテゴリ英語の代わりに別の言語でヘルプ


    [email protected](("Memory","Available MBytes"), 
     ("Memory","Free System Page Table Entries"), 
     )
$ppt = New-Object System.Diagnostics.PerformanceCounter $ppt2 = New-OBject System.Diagnostics.PerformanceCounterCategory

foreach($it in $n){   
     $ppt.categoryName=$it[0] 
     $ppt.counterName=$it[1] 
     $ppt2.categoryName =$it[0] 
     $var = $ppt2.categoryName 
     $var2 = $ppt.counterName 
     $ppt.instanceName ='' 

     echo "CategoryName : $var " 
     echo ("Category Help : " + $ppt2.CategoryHelp) 
     echo "CounterName : $var2" 
     echo ("CounterHelp : " + $ppt.counterHelp) 
     echo "" 
} 

表示の説明を書いたPowerShellのコードビットこれはCounterHelpと英語の説明で分類ヘルプの私に与えます。そのカウンターやカテゴリのドイツ語の説明を取得するにはどのようにしても、英語のWindowsを使用します。私はドイツのWindowsで試しましたが、うまくいきませんでした。英語のウィンドウでは不可能な場合。ドイツのWindowsで何が間違っていたのですか? Thx

答えて

0

Windowsのドイツ語版が必要です。私はドイツのWindows 7バージョンを使用します。

カテゴリとカウンターのドイツ語のヘルプテキストを取得するには、ドイツ語の名前を使用する必要があります。

変更:

[email protected](("Memory","Available MBytes")) 

に:マイクロソフト\ Windowsの NT \

HKEY_LOCAL_MACHINE \ソフトウェア:

[email protected](("Arbeitsspeicher","Verfügbare MB")) 

あなたは、レジストリ内の英語カテゴリとカウンター名を検索します\ CurrentVersion \ Perflib \ 009

ドイツ語名に:

HKEY_LOCAL_MACHINE \ソフトウェア\マイクロソフト\ Windowsの NT \ CurrentVersionの\のPerflib \ 007

関連する問題